Steam's Linux game library is quite un-impressive when you count in how poorly many of them including most AAA titles actually work on SteamOS and other Linux distro's.

Allot of them aren't natively ported by rather use middle ware like the one offered by Transgaming which is no more than an optimized version of Wine.

Not to mention that many of the "AAA" titles will have either a much higher system requirement for Linux or outright just not support hardware which is supported on Winodws.

For example Borderlands The Pre-Sequel doesn't supports AMD cards at all on Linux and has double the minimum requirements of the Windows version.

So sorry while Linux gaming has come a long long way it's still not something that you can call viable for "Gamers".

If you only play old titles and indie games you are probably fine tho...
